While the rules allow him to release it, they specifically cite Department of Justice policy that generally says prosecutors should not talk about people who are investigated but not charged to protect them from having their reputations smeared. During Barr’s confirmation hearing, Democrats in Congress pushed him to commit to release the full report, but he repeatedly declined to do so.
On the other hand, another part of the special counsel rules requires the attorney general to make his own report. That report goes to the chairman and ranking member of the Judiciary committees in the House and Senate.
